Transaction 63d5773813612d274a9dbb9e43081aead69a525076530108cc5de90ae62b2893

1 Input
2 Outputs
  • 63d5773813612d274a9dbb9e43081aead69a525076530108cc5de90ae62b2893:0
  • value  11165000
    address  3Fw21txYPQkWdQd5FyaCSks2eTJGNQ7mzz
  • 63d5773813612d274a9dbb9e43081aead69a525076530108cc5de90ae62b2893:1
  • value  38650
    address  bc1qpa2m455cjtg3wly6us57tnxy45jgaw93r4ddx2